Effective transition from pediatric to adult endocrinology care requires improved communication and collaboration between specialists. Establishing dedicated transition clinics is crucial for managing patients with chronic endocrine diseases into adulthood.

Area of Science:

  • Endocrinology
  • Pediatrics
  • Internal Medicine

Context:

  • Patients with chronic congenital or childhood-onset endocrinological diseases often remain under pediatric care well into adulthood.
  • A significant gap exists in communication and collaboration between pediatricians and adult endocrinologists.
  • This lack of interdisciplinary cooperation hinders the successful transition of adolescent patients to adult healthcare.

Purpose:

  • To highlight the critical need for improved collaboration between pediatric and adult endocrinology specialists.
  • To emphasize the importance of establishing specialized transition clinics for patients with chronic endocrine conditions.
  • To advocate for a networked approach involving various healthcare providers to enhance patient management.

Summary:

  • Chronic endocrine disease management extends beyond pediatric care into adulthood due to poor communication between pediatricians and internists.
  • Intensive cooperation is essential for a smooth transition, with transition clinics playing a vital role.
  • Few university centers have implemented such clinics, necessitating a network structure involving multiple healthcare settings.
  • Impact:

    • Enhanced collaboration and the establishment of transition clinics can significantly improve the management and stability of adult patients with chronic endocrine diseases.
    • Overcoming sectoral boundaries and creating integrated networks are key to improving care quality.
    • There is an urgent need to implement transition clinics, potentially through model projects, to address this gap in care.
